What Is Lily of the Valley?

Lily of the Valley, scientifically known as Convallaria majalis, is a woodland flowering plant native to Europe and parts of Asia.

Although its blossoms possess one of nature's most enchanting aromas, they produce virtually no essential oil.

For this reason, perfumers recreate the scent through carefully balanced fragrance accords that capture its fresh, dewy, and airy floral character.

This artistry has made Lily of the Valley one of perfumery's most celebrated floral notes.

The Bright Heart of a Fragrance

Lily of the Valley most often appears in the heart notes of a fragrance.

Its radiant floral accord links sparkling citrus openings with soft woods and musk's, creating a composition that feels bright, harmonious, and elegant.

Rather than dominating, it quietly elevates the fragrance with freshness and clarity.
